Embracing the Pacific Spirit: A Journey of Freedom and Identity

Drew Chadwick's song "Pacific" is a vibrant celebration of the West Coast lifestyle, encapsulating the essence of freedom, camaraderie, and a deep connection to the natural world. The lyrics paint a picture of a life lived with passion and intensity, where the Pacific Ocean serves as both a backdrop and a source of inspiration. Chadwick's references to the "pacific kinda vision" and "reppin' that pacific" suggest a strong identification with the culture and ethos of the Pacific Coast, characterized by a laid-back yet adventurous spirit.

The song's narrative follows Chadwick's personal journey, from leaving his hometown at 17 to finding a sense of belonging and purpose by the ocean. The imagery of "listening to sounds of the tides" and "drowning in light" evokes a sense of spiritual awakening and connection to the natural world. This connection is further emphasized by the recurring theme of living in the moment, as seen in lines like "time is an illusion, never hit the pause" and "breathin like it's the last night alive." The song captures the essence of seizing the day and embracing life's fleeting moments with vigor and enthusiasm.

Chadwick also highlights the importance of community and shared experiences, as evidenced by references to "throwin down with the tribe" and "out here with tha squad feelin like a God." The camaraderie and collective joy of these moments are central to the song's message, underscoring the idea that true fulfillment comes from shared experiences and a sense of belonging. The song's upbeat tempo and energetic delivery further amplify this sense of celebration and unity, making "Pacific" a powerful anthem for those who identify with the West Coast lifestyle and its values of freedom, adventure, and community.
